DBSyncer:全面支持多种数据库的数据同步解决方案
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
资源摘要信息:"DBSyncer是一款开源的数据同步中间件,它支持多种数据库系统之间的数据同步,包括MySQL、Oracle、SqlServer、PostgreSQL、Elasticsearch(ES)、Kafka、File、SQL等。DBSyncer不仅支持全量数据同步,还支持增量数据同步,以满足不同场景下对数据同步的需求。DBSyncer还提供了监控功能,可以实时查看数据同步的状态,包括全量和增量数据的统计图,以及应用性能预警,帮助用户及时发现并处理可能出现的问题。DBSyncer的另一个亮点是支持上传插件自定义同步转换业务,这使得DBSyncer具有很强的扩展性,可以根据用户的具体需求进行定制化开发。" 知识点一:开源数据同步中间件 数据同步中间件是一种软件,它位于不同的数据源之间,负责数据的提取、转换和加载(ETL)过程,确保数据在各个系统之间保持一致性。DBSyncer作为开源中间件,意味着其源代码对公众开放,社区可以自由地使用、研究、修改和分发。 知识点二:支持的数据库系统 DBSyncer支持包括MySQL、Oracle、SqlServer、PostgreSQL在内的多种数据库系统。这些数据库系统广泛应用于不同规模的企业和项目中,拥有各自的特色和优势。DBSyncer能够同步这些不同数据库系统之间的数据,对于多数据库环境的企业而言,是一种非常有用的数据整合工具。 知识点三:数据同步场景 DBSyncer提供了多种数据同步场景,包括但不限于: - 全量同步:指同步整个数据库或表的全部数据。 - 增量同步:指仅同步自上次同步以来发生变化的数据。 - 插件自定义同步:用户可以根据自己的业务需求开发特定的数据同步转换逻辑,通过上传插件实现。 知识点四:监控功能 DBSyncer提供了监控功能,可以实时监控数据同步状态。这包括对全量和增量数据的统计分析以及应用性能的预警机制。监控功能能够帮助用户了解数据同步的进度和效率,及时发现并处理可能出现的数据错误或同步延迟问题。 知识点五:上传插件自定义同步转换业务 DBSyncer支持上传插件来自定义同步转换业务。这一特性提供了强大的灵活性和扩展性,允许开发者编写并集成自定义的同步逻辑。通过这种方式,用户可以根据自己的业务场景,实现特定的数据同步需求,从而让DBSyncer的应用场景更加广泛。 知识点六:应用场景 DBSyncer适用于多种应用场景,如: - 数据库迁移:在更换数据库系统或升级现有系统时,使用DBSyncer同步数据。 - 数据备份:定期或实时备份数据到另一系统,以防止数据丢失。 - 数据仓库:构建数据仓库时,从多个数据源同步数据到仓库。 - 实时数据处理:对实时数据流进行处理,如从事件日志、消息队列等同步数据到分析系统。 - 跨云同步:在不同云平台之间同步数据,或者在本地和云之间同步数据。 以上知识点涵盖了DBSyncer的核心功能和特点,为数据同步中间件的用户和开发者提供了丰富的参考信息。
- 1
- 2
- 3
- 4
- 5
- 6
- 9
- 粉丝: 1w+
- 资源: 7154
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 彩虹rain bow point鼠标指针压缩包使用指南
- C#开发的C++作业自动批改系统
- Java实战项目:城市公交查询系统及部署教程
- 深入掌握Spring Boot基础技巧与实践
- 基于SSM+Mysql的校园通讯录信息管理系统毕业设计源码
- 精选简历模板分享:简约大气,适用于应届生与在校生
- 个性化Windows桌面:自制图标大全指南
- 51单片机超声波测距项目源码解析
- 掌握SpringBoot实战:深度学习笔记解析
- 掌握Java基础语法的关键知识点
- SSM+mysql邮件管理系统毕业设计源码免费下载
- wkhtmltox下载困难?找到正确的安装包攻略
- Python全栈开发项目资源包 - 功能复刻与开发支持
- 即时消息分发系统架构设计:以tio为基础
- 基于SSM框架和MySQL的在线书城项目源码
- 认知OFDM技术在802.11标准中的项目实践